What are the consequences of not replacing missing teeth?

Unfortunately, not everyone is aware of the negative impact on health and appearance of not replacing missing teeth. What exactly can this result in, both aesthetically and in terms of health?

Movement of remaining teeth

The first major impact of failure to replace missing teeth is the displacement of remaining teeth. In the long term, this can lead, among other things, to the development of malocclusion and, in extreme cases, even to further loss of teeth, especially in the elderly. Frequent pain

Another consequence is pain resulting from excessive tension in the mouth, as well as overloading of the remaining teeth. The result can even be a seemingly unrelated headache, resulting in chewing problems.

Bruxism

Bruxism, or the grinding of teeth, is in many cases a psychosomatic rather than a purely dental disease. However, it turns out that dental cavities that have not been filled for years can also lead to it. It is the result of excessive tension in the chewing muscles, which in a more advanced stage leads to cracking and loosening of teethand their hypersensitivity.

Deteriorated facial appearance

In addition, aesthetic considerations should not be forgotten. For it turns out that cavities often also result in the collapse of the skin coverings. This results in the collapse of the corners of the mouth and the formation of nasolabial furrowswhich make the face look sadder and slightly older.
